Do you use Open Source in your daily work? At home? Elsewhere? Do you use
oVirt?

Personally, I think it's best to start contributing to software you
actually use.

If you are interested in oVirt, you should probably start by looking around
https://www.ovirt.org/develop/ .

If in "easy first contribution" you refer to a code change/patch, then I
might warn you that it's not really that "easy", if you have no experience
with oVirt and related technologies as a user, first. I think it took me
around a month, back then...
